United States

After planning to take the station silent in March, Cumulus Media has agreed to sell Conservative Talk “Talk 1270WHLD Niagara Falls/Buffalo NY to Buddy Shula’s Radio One Buffalo for $150,000. Shula currently owns Oldies “Big WECK” 1230 WECK Cheektowaga with three translators in the Buffalo market and Yacht Rock “Key 93.7” WKEY-FM Key West FL. An LMA will take effect on June 1.

Holy Family Communications sells its trio of 730 WACE Chicopee/Springfield, 1230 WNEB Worcester, and 970 WESO/101.1 W266DK Southbridge MA to Journey For Life Media for $150,000. The stations currently operate as part of the seller’s Catholic “Stations of the Cross” network.

Tómas Tate buys 1220 WSTL/93.7 W229AN Providence RI from Nelson Diaz’s Diaz Holdings for $450,000. WSTL currently serves as the parent of Spanish CHR “Mega 94.9” W235CN with the translator operating as Hip Hop “The Juice” fed bu Audacy’s 103.7 WVEI-HD2.

Laos

567, Lao National Radio, 0347+ UT, May 8 (Thursday), via Kiwi SDR remote at So. Phisal, Thailand. Surprised to hear that LNR still broadcasts a VOA program; “Teaching Tips,” in English and Laotian, about gender and equality in the classroom; with a vocabulary segment; pop song (Justin Timberlake – “Can’t Stop The Feeling”).

Sweden

During the big car-show in Gothenburg [on May 24th and 25th] the Radiomuseum will make a transmission to all old cars with AM-radio.
We have a permit on 981 kHz (the traditional MW-frequency for Gothenburg).
Only 10 W ERP – music 24 hours from Radio SBG during the weekend.

New Zealand

There have been some major changes on the AM band in New Zealand, with some AM stations changing some time back and others changing more recently.

531kHz More FM Alexandra NZL has closed its AM frequency and now operates on FM.
639kHz RNZ National Alexandra NZL has closed its AM frequency and now operates on FM.
711kHz Sport Nation Wellington NZL has closed this frequency and now operates on 1233kHz.
891kHz Magic Wellington NZL has closed its AM frequency and now operates on FM.
927kHz Newstalk ZB Palmerston North NZL has closed its AM frequency and now operates on FM.
1071kHz RNZ National Masterton NZL has closed its AM frequency and now operates on FM.
1089kHz Gold/Sport Palmerston North NZL has closed its AM frequency and now operates on FM.
1134kHz RNZ National Queenstown NZL has closed its AM frequency and now operates on FM.
1449kHz RNZ National Palmerston North NZL has closed its AM frequency and now operates on FM.
Also, All SENZ stations now identify as Sport Nation and all Star stations now identify as Sanctuary. The format of each respective network remain sport and religious programming.

Papua New Guinea

The National Broadcasting Corporation’s provincial station for the autonomous region of Bougainville is looking into ways of improving NBC radio signals throughout the region.
MEDIUM WAVE
Technical teams have identified a possible site for a medium wave transmitter which should improve the clarity of NBC radio signals, helping the current FM signals. This site is to accommodate a 10kw Nautel medium-wave transmitter, which has already been ordered.
SHORT WAVE
NBC engineers are also going to Hutjena Buka to observe the possible resumption of short-wave transmission. They plan to use the shortwave transmitter that is currently inactive. It would only need a few parts to be fully operational. These parts have already been purchased and are now awaiting installation. The transmitter would be a 10 kW NEC HFB-7840 manufactured in the early 90s.
Since the early 2020s, a major programme of public investment has been unleashed to renovate NBC’s headquarters and regional stations.
Combining the FM network with shortwave and medium-wave transmitters will bring NBC radio signals to communities nationwide and internationally.
